How We Live - Community

Community life is at the heart of our religious commitment. We live together and care for one another as brothers. We vow to live with other Franciscan brothers and priests as witnesses to the Gospel. While we are involved with active ministry, we also stress a life of prayer and contemplation. We daily pray the Liturgy of Hours together and share in Eucharist. We also have retreats, days of recollection, and monthly house chapters. These chapters are spiritual days when we purposely share our faith, discuss house business, and evaluate our faithfulness to our commitment.

Living with other Friars allows us to keep focused on our vows and to share mutual support through common meals and fraternity. In a world of constant motion and and apparent chaos, it allows us to slow down and image the value of Christian communal living as exemplified by the early disciples. In the heart of the mystery of God; Father, Son and Holy Spirit, is relationship. Consequently, our relationships with one another in community help us to grow in relationship with God and with everyone we serve.
